Undergraduate student Yvonne Giesecke recently travelled to Chicago to attend the Experimental Biology Conference 2017 to present some of her research.  Yvonne said

It was such a great opportunity to present some of my undergraduate research at a big international conference.  I attended many talks from experts in the field, which was a great inspiration for further research.  Generally it was a really helpful experience to present my research to a critical audience of other researchers and to discuss further research methods that could be used.  I was also nominated as a finalist for the undergraduate poster prize of the American Association of Anatomists.  My poster was assessed by a panel during my regular poster presentation time.  I received a great feedback which will definitely be helpful for any presentations in my further career.  I was also extremely happy to be awarded the second prize for my presentation. Overall attending the conference in Chicago has been a really important experience and opportunity for me.

I would also like to thank both of my supervisors for this project: Dr John Lucocq (University of St Andrews School of Medicine) and Dr Kerim Mutig (Charite Universitaetsmedizin Berlin).
